Sarah Boone appears in court with new lawyer ahead of murder trial

SUMMARY: In a recent court session regarding the case of Sarah Boon, defense attorney Mr. Owens discussed various motions, a motion for a statement of particulars, additional discovery requests, and the appointment of mental experts. The defense argued that the ‘s filings were insufficiently detailed to prepare an adequate defense related to a battered spouse syndrome claim. The court evaluated the defense’s claims, the state’s response, and the unique circumstances of the case. Ultimately, the court denied some motions while granting the appointment of experts, also noting the importance of timely discovery in relation to the trial for October 7. The court emphasized the need for clarity around witness testimonies and relevant evidence regarding the defense strategy. Further hearings and motions may occur as the trial date approaches.

Sarah Boone, the Florida woman accused of murder for allegedly leaving her boyfriend in a suitcase to die, appears in court with her new lawyer.

Doctor gets TMS approved for teens

SUMMARY: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ation (TMS) is now FDA-cleared for aged 15 and older as a non-medicated depression treatment. Dr. Melissa Ficki, a child and adult psychiatrist, highlights TMS as a significant advancement, providing an alternative for youth suffering from mental disorders. Unlike ECT, TMS is non-invasive and works by sending magnetic pulses to the brain regions involved in emotional regulation, helping to activate underactive neurons. This treatment aims to make mental health more accessible, offering families another option besides medication and therapy. Experts hope to expand TMS approval for younger and additional mental health conditions in the future.

Dr. Melissa Fickey is a child and adult psychiatrist and founder of Embracing Wellness Center in Hillsborough County. She worked with a group to get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ation, or TMS, cleared by the FDA for teens ages 15 and older.

Watching for possible disturbance in Caribbean

SUMMARY: Fox 35 Storm Team meteorologist is tracking a potential hurricane developing next in the Gulf of Mexico. Currently, there are three of interest, with the Caribbean area having a 40% of tropical development. While models are uncertain, favorable conditions for storm formation include warm waters and light wind shear. Two scenarios are possible: a cold front could steer the system toward Florida, or a high-pressure ridge might push it westward towards Texas or . Historical patterns suggest Florida is more likely to be affected. Updates will continue as the situation develops.

The odds of a tropical disturbance developing in the northwestern Caribbean Sea and southeastern Gulf of Mexico have increased, according to the National Hurricane Center (NHC).
